Dry Climate is witnessed by regular evaporation and transpiration that surpasses the level of precipitation. Dry climate is spread along the areas from 20 - 35º North and South of the equator and the continental regions of the mid-latitudes.

Yes and No. You have to remember that 32ºF is equal to 0ºC. This is the point in which water freezes. So 6ºC is about 40ºF, which is a cold day, but no need for earmuffs and scarfs. It also depends on where you live in the world. Some places might think that 6ºC is very warm, like Greenland. Places near the equator would think that 6ºC is very, very cold.
